Abington, Pa- The Penn State Berk men's tennis team were edged out by Penn St. Abington falling by a score of 5-4 on Saturday, Apr. 13.
Berks jumped out to an early lead in the match, winning two of three doubles matches. The team of Muhammad Esmat and Jazae Maina-Itegi won the #1 doubles match by a score of 8-5. The Lions also won the #2 doubles match, with the team of Weston Weaver and Donovan Sullivan picking up the 8-5 victory.
The Lions were not as successful in double play, but Sullivan earned a 7-5, 6-1 victory in the #3 singles match. Weaver also picked up a singles victory, outlasting his opponent in a thrilling 7-5, 4-6, 11-9 victory. Abington captured the other four singles matches, rallying for the 5-4 victory.
The Lions will have a quick turnaround, traveling to face Penn College on Sunday, Apr. 14. The match is scheduled for 1:00 PM.
